The Indian EdTech landscape has undergone a major evolution. The market has shifted heavily away from aggressive online marketing toward **hybrid models (online + offline), sustainable pricing, and heavy AI integration for hyper-personalized learning**. The top Indian EdTech platforms are categorized below based on their focus area, market dominance, and credibility: --- ## 1. Test Prep & Competitive Exams (JEE, NEET, UPSC, Government Exams) * **Physics Wallah (PW):** The undisputed leader in terms of market sentiment and scale. Following its successful stock market IPO in late 2025, PW has expanded aggressively into physical hybrid centers (Vidyapeeth) across India. It remains the top choice for middle-class students due to its highly affordable pricing, regional language content, and high student trust. * **Unacademy:** A major player in the high-stakes exam market (UPSC, CAT, NEET). While it retains a massive network of top educators and multi-lingual live classes online, it has also expanded heavily into its offline "Unacademy Centres" to compete directly with traditional coaching institutes. * **Adda247 & Testbook:** These platforms dominate the tier-2, tier-3, and rural sectors. They specialize in banking, SSC, railways, and state government exam preparations, heavily relying on vernacular (local language) content and hyper-affordable, mobile-first mock tests. --- ## 2. Higher Education & Professional Upskilling * **upGrad:** Indiaโ€™s premier higher education EdTech unicorn. It specializes in online degrees (MBAs, BBA, Data Science) and executive certifications in collaboration with top tier global and Indian universities. * **Simplilearn:** Known for its job-oriented bootcamps and digital tech certifications (AI, Cloud Computing, Cybersecurity). They partner with elite institutions like Caltech and Purdue to provide industry-aligned credentials. * **AlmaBetter:** A rising star focusing heavily on **outcome-based education**. They offer job-assured programs in Data Science, AI, and Software Engineering, partnering with entities like IIT Guwahati to offer globally recognized certificates. --- ## 3. K-12 & School-Level Tutoring * **Vedantu:** A pioneer in live, interactive online classes. Vedantu utilizes an AI-driven learning insights engine to track student engagement, offer real-time doubt solving, and simulate a personalized physical classroom environment online. * **LEAD School & Classplus:** Rather than targeting students directly, these platforms empower the ecosystem. LEAD integrates directly into private schools to provide tech-enabled curriculum and teacher training, while Classplus helps local independent tutors run their own online teaching apps. --- ## ๐Ÿ’ก Emerging Trends: What Makes an EdTech "The Best"? 1. **The Hybrid ("Phygital") Shift:** Purely online video packages have lost popularity. The best platforms combine online convenience with physical offline classrooms for accountability. 2. **AI-First Personalization:** Platforms are integrating structural AI tools (like real-time doubt solvers and automated essay graders) to give every student a customized learning path. 3. **Focus on Outcomes:** The industry has shifted away from simply selling course access to proving job placements, higher test scores, and tangible skill-building. The best Indian EdTech companies in 2026 are defined by a massive shift toward **"Phygital" (hybrid physical + digital) learning spaces**, AI-driven personalization, and a strict focus on career outcomes. Following the market corrections of recent years, companies relying on pure-play online K-12 structures have given way to sustainable, outcome-focused ecosystem leaders. The top Indian EdTech companies are classified below by their primary learning sectors. Test Prep & K-12 (Phygital Leaders) - **PhysicsWallah**: The top-ranked EdTech company in India by performance and market cap following its successful **$5.2 billion IPO**. It dominates through its hybrid "Vidyapeeth" physical offline classrooms integrated with online learning apps. - **Unacademy**: A market giant for national competitive exams like UPSC, IIT-JEE, and NEET. It uses an extensive hybrid network of offline centres alongside its digital test prep ecosystem. - **Allen Digital / Motion**: Traditional brick-and-mortar coaching powerhouses that successfully digitised their setups to capture the hybrid test prep market. Higher Education & Professional Upskilling - **upGrad**: The market leader for higher education, online degrees, and executive upskilling. It focuses closely on corporate partnerships, job readiness, and AI/Data Science curricula. - **Eruditus**: A premium global executive education platform that partners with elite Indian and international universities to offer certified business and tech leadership programs. - **Simplilearn**: An outcome-based bootcamp platform specialising in technical certifications, cloud computing, and digital marketing for working professionals. - **Scaler Academy / NxtWave**: High-density tech finishing schools designed specifically for software engineering aspirants, emphasizing live project portfolios over generic theory. B2B & Institutional School Software - **LEAD School**: A full-stack academic system that provides comprehensive curriculum, software, and training frameworks directly to small and medium schools across India. - **Teachmint**: A major infrastructure provider that delivers integrated Learning Management Systems (LMS) and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) tools to schools and private tutors.
